Effect of degree-day temperature on climate change in Dongxing |
Huang Lichao1,Chen Guodi2 |
1.Dongxing Meteorological Bureau of Guangxi,Dongxing 538100; 2.Fangchenggang Meteorological Bureau of Guangxi,Fangchenggang 538001 |
|
|
Abstract According to daily average temperature of national basic meteorological stationin Dongxing from Jan.1st,1955 to Dec.31th,2010,the trend of average monthly andannual heating degree-day (HDD) and cooling degree-day (CDD) isanalyzed by climate statistics.In the context of global warming,the impact of degree-day temperature on climate change is revealed,and the effect of degree-day temperatureon the energy is also discussed.The results show that the average monthly HDD isconcentrated from April to November with its peaks in January and February.Theaverage monthly CDD is focused from May to October with its peaks in Julyand August.The HDD variation for many yeas presents downward trend that is opposite toCDD variation.The decreasing and increasing rate of HDD and CDD is -21.8 ℃ / 10a and 22.3 ℃ / 10a respectively.It has a significant correlation among averagetemperature,HDD and CDD,whose correlation coefficients are all pass significance test a=0.001.The relationship between HDD and average temperature shows negative correlation trend,while it presents positive correlation trendbetween CDD and the average temperature.This trend is influenced by climate warming with decreasing HDD value and increasing CDD value,which indicates that thecooling consumption in summer will be enhanced.
